- WooCommerce Cart Empties After Refresh: Sessions and Cache Fixes That Actually Work
- MySQL vs MariaDB: WooCommerce checkout lag—one setting fixes it, the other just masks it
- WordPress 504 Gateway Timeout: Is It the Database or PHP? How to Prove Which One
- WordPress Database Bloated: wp_options Autoload Cleanup Without Breaking Things
- WordPress Can’t Upload Images: Fast Troubleshooting for Permissions, Limits, and Libraries
- Tabs and Accordions Without Libraries: details/summary + Progressive Enhancement
- WooCommerce Critical Error After Update: Roll Back and Recover Safely
- WooCommerce Checkout Not Working: Diagnose SSL, Payments, and Plugin Conflicts
- Apache for WordPress: Modules and Rules That Break Sites (and How to Fix Them)
- WordPress File Permissions Errors: What 755/644 Should Be and Why
- WordPress .htaccess Broke the Site: Restore a Safe Default Properly
- WordPress 503 Service Unavailable: what to check when the site is down
- WordPress “max_input_vars”: Why Menus and Forms Break, and How to Fix It
- WordPress “Max execution time exceeded”: why it happens and safe fixes
- WordPress emails go to spam: SPF/DKIM/DMARC explained and configured
- WordPress caching that doesn’t break carts and forms
- WordPress 502 Bad Gateway: PHP-FPM, Nginx, Cloudflare — How to Find the Culprit
- WordPress Update Failed: Fix Permissions, Disk Space, and Ownership the Right Way
- WordPress 429 Too Many Requests: bots, rate limits, Cloudflare — how to fix
- WordPress 100% CPU usage: find the plugin/bot hammering your site
- WordPress + Cloudflare Cache Settings That Won’t Break wp-admin
- WordPress Plugin Requires Newer PHP: What to Do When Hosting Is Outdated
- WordPress Too Many Redirects: Fixing www/https/Cloudflare Redirect Loops
- WordPress PHP Version Incompatibility: Check and Upgrade Without Downtime
- WordPress “Memory exhausted”: raise memory limits the right way (where it matters)
- WordPress Domain Migration Without Losing SEO: 301s, Canonicals, Sitemaps, and Zero Drama
- WordPress Not Sending Email: SMTP Setup That Actually Delivers
- WooCommerce Slow Admin Orders: Find Heavy Queries and Speed Them Up
- WordPress Mixed Content: why HTTPS still shows warnings and how to fix properly